20100147260 | DIRECT FUEL-INJECTION ENGINE - A direct fuel-injection engine includes a piston, a cavity recessed in a central part of a top face of the piston, and a fuel injector. At a main injection collision point of a fuel-injection axis when main injection is performed while the piston is near top dead center, a main injection collision angle formed between its tangent and the fuel-injection axis is set at an obtuse angle. Fuel colliding with the main injection collision point is deflected towards a cavity open end side. At a secondary injection collision point of the fuel-injection axis when performing secondary injection with the piston is further from top dead center, a secondary injection collision angle formed between its tangent and the fuel-injection axis is set at one of a right angle and an acute angle. Fuel colliding with the secondary injection collision point is deflected primarily in the circumferential direction of the cavity. | 06-17-2010 |

20150259659 | METHOD FOR OBTAINING NATURAL VARIANT OF ENZYME AND SUPER THERMOSTABLE CELLOBIOHYDROLASE - A method for selectively obtaining a natural variant of an enzyme having activity includes (1) a step of detecting an ORF sequence of a protein having enzyme activity from a genome database including base sequences of metagenomic DNA of environmental microbiota; (2) a step of obtaining at least one PCR clone including the ORF sequence having a full length, a partial sequence of the ORF sequence, or a base sequence encoding an amino acid sequence which is formed by deletion, substitution, or addition of at least one amino acid residue in an amino acid sequence encoded by the ORF sequence, by performing PCR cloning on at least one metagenomic DNA of the environmental microbiota by using a primer designed based on the ORF sequence; (3) a step of determining a base sequence and an amino acid sequence which is encoded by the base sequence for each PCR clone obtained in the step (2); and (4) a step of selecting a natural variant of an enzyme having activity by measuring enzyme activity of proteins encoded by each PCR clone obtained in the step (2). | 09-17-2015 |

20150210234 | SUSPENSION STRUCTURE FOR IRREGULAR GROUND TRAVELING VEHICLE - A suspension structure for an irregular ground traveling vehicle includes an upper arm and a lower arm, a drive shaft, a boot, and an outer guard. The upper and lower arms each have one end portion supported on a vehicle body frame. The drive shaft is disposed between the upper arm and the lower arm and transmits a drive force to a wheel. The boot covers an end portion of the drive shaft on a wheel side. The outer guard member covers a front side of the boot. A brake line, which extends from a caliper, is arranged within a width of the wheel and below the upper arm, and the outer guard member extends to an area in the vicinity of the upper arm. | 07-30-2015 |

20130255237 | EXHAUST SYSTEM FOR VARIABLE CYLINDER ENGINE - An exhaust system for a variable cylinder engine for assuring purification of exhaust gas without increasing the number of catalysts and an intake system for purifying blow-by gas. The exhaust system includes an activation side exhaust pipe connected to an activation cylinder group that operates normally. A deactivation side exhaust pipe is connected to a deactivation cylinder group wherein fuel supply is stopped under a particular condition. A gathering section is connected to downstream ends of the activation side exhaust pipe and the deactivation side exhaust pipe with a sub-catalyst disposed in the activation side exhaust pipe and a main catalyst disposed at the gathering section. The main catalyst is formed wherein gas passing therethrough is partitioned into flows independent of each other in a flow path direction. The activation side exhaust pipe and the deactivation side exhaust pipe are connected in a mutually independent state to the main catalyst. | 10-03-2013 |

20090184542 | REAR VEHICLE BODY STRUCTURE - A pair of rear floor frames extend in a fore-and-aft direction in a lower part of a vehicle body. A pair of rear horizontal frames extend in the fore-and-aft direction above corresponding rear wheels. A door beam extends in the fore-and-aft direction in each side door in alignment with the corresponding rear horizontal frame. A pair of rear vertical frames each extend vertically behind the corresponding rear wheel and join rear ends of the corresponding rear floor frame and rear horizontal frame to each other. In a rear end crash with a vehicle having a front bumper at a relatively high position, the rear vertical frames allow the impact energy of the rear end crash to be evenly distributed, and deformation of the passenger compartment is minimized. The rear horizontal frames allow the impact energy to be transmitted to the door beams, contributing to reinforcement of the passenger compartment. | 07-23-2009 |
20090195030 | REAR VEHICLE BODY STRUCTURE - In a rear vehicle body structure, a spare tire is received in a spare tire pan in a rear end up slanted orientation, the front end of the spare tire is prevented from forward movement by a spare tire pan cross member, and a rear bottom of the spare tire pan is reinforced. At the time of a rear end crash, the spare tire is tilted substantially to an upright orientation around the front end, and the spare tire pan is deformed such that the rear bottom is folded upon a front bottom wall in the shape of letter Z as seen from side so that the spare tire pan provides a long deformation stroke, and is utilized for absorbing the impact energy of the rear end crash. Preferably, the rear bottom comprises an elevated horizontal part and a stepped portion defining a front edge of the elevated horizontal part. | 08-06-2009 |
